An interview with Pope Francis reveals his thoughts on personal and controversial topics, including his vision of the church, stance on gays and lesbians, and his own humanity.
Contents: New way of being church. -- Pope engaged in the world. -- Francis the witness. -- Alleluia! -- Call of the spirit. -- Work of a Christian lifetime. -- Ongoing conversation. -- One human family. -- Mercy-ing. -- Accessible Pope. -- Pope's interview and the Biblr. -- People of God, at long last.
